Know what is causing your own stress. It is crucial to understand just what in life is causing your stress. Stress can be caused by a lot of things: a situation, object or an event. Once you narrow down what the causes of your stress are, you can try to minimize or eliminate it.

A fun way to reduce your stress down is to get a professional massage. Tense muscles in the body. A massage can relax your muscles and leave you feeling more relaxed and less stressed out.

Use music to help relive your stress. Music has a powerful control over your emotions. Several studies have shown that listening to music helps people to relax. The key is to learn what kind of music has the best ability to soothe you, as everyone is different.

Take inventory of your current coping skills and see if you can deal with stress. Try recording your responses to stressful situations over a stress journal for a few weeks. Looking at your notes will allow you to decide if it was productive and healthy.If the way you handled stress only made things worse, then try to devise a new coping strategy that will help you to deal with things on a day to day basis.

Talking with other people can be a great way to reduce your stress. Expressing your anxieties and emotions can help you feel better.

Be aware of any body parts that tightens up when you feel stressed. Often people clench their lower back muscles, lower back muscles, shoulders or teeth. When you figure out where you usually store tension, consciously stretch these spots often when you are under stress. This will alleviate your stress levels and help relax you.

Figure out what causes the most stress for you and try to eliminate that factor or cut down on it significantly. A friend who is much more of a hindrance than a help in your life, for example, should not be invited over very often, nor should you spend much time with a constantly complaining co-worker. By eliminating the stresses you have some control over gives you more time to deal with the ones you cannot avoid. You will be better equipped to handle them.

Imagine calming scenes to relieve your stress. It has been shown that looking at images that exude soothing feelings can be successful at reducing your stress levels. Try to imagine yourself somewhere calm and peaceful, such as a pleasant garden or a relaxing beach, and let your stress drain away. Taking the time to imagine a calm and relaxing place should help to relieve any anxiety that you have.
